まったくの初心者、初投稿です。
スプレッドシートのチェックボックスを押すとカウントするスクリプトで
どうやらトリガーがちゃんと作動していません。
スクリプトは以下で、トリガーは「変更時」。
参考サイトはこちらです。
https://hebi.motiken.fun/2019/02/02/spread-check/
おなじ行程を別のアカウントですると作動するので
アカウントの設定の問題なのか…
チェックボックスを押してもトリガーは「完了」となり
エラー表示されないので原因が分かりません。
試しにメッセージボックスをだすという
スクリプトのみだと実行できました。
該当のソースコード
function myFunction() { var sheet = SpreadsheetApp.getActiveSheet(); var cl = sheet.getActiveCell(); var co = cl.offset(0,1); var coValue = co.getValue(); var flag = cl.getValue(); if(cl.getColumn() == 2 && flag == true) { coValue += 1; Browser.msgBox(coValue + "回目です"); co.setValue(coValue); cl.setValue(false); } }
よろしくお願い致します。
回答1件
あなたの回答
tips
プレビュー